Implemented in 2023

On January 1, 2023, the Company adopted the new Accounting Standards Update (“ASU”) 2021-08, issued by the Financial Accounting Standards Board (“FASB”), and all related amendments under FASB Accounting Standards Codification (“ASC”), Topic 805, Business Combinations, Accounting for Contract Assets and Contract Liabilities from Contracts with Customers in anticipation of obtaining effective control of KCS. The amendment introduces the requirement for an acquirer to recognize and measure contract assets and contract liabilities acquired in a business combination in accordance with the requirements of FASB ASC Topic 606, Revenue from Contracts with Customers, rather than at fair value. The Company assumed control of KCS (through an indirect wholly owned subsidiary) on April 14, 2023. This update will be applied prospectively to contract assets and liabilities within the scope of this amendment, which includes any contract assets and liabilities of KCS that will be recorded in the purchase price allocation. The adoption of this update will not have a material impact to the Company's financial statements. See Note 15 for further discussion on the Company's acquisition of KCS.

All other accounting pronouncements that became effective during the period covered by the Interim Consolidated Financial Statements did not have a material impact on the Company’s Consolidated Financial statements and related disclosures.
